diff options
author | Miroslav Šulc <fordfrog@gentoo.org> | 2011-12-26 13:36:30 +0000 |
---|---|---|
committer | Miroslav Šulc <fordfrog@gentoo.org> | 2011-12-26 13:36:30 +0000 |
commit | 1041c08acbf2e232e3a18f4f57482c432a65e386 (patch) | |
tree | 7bfbfd475b090acc80d7031a634d6488714091a6 /dev-util | |
parent | [dev-java/asm] asm-4.0 moved to the tree. Keeping rc1 for LWJGL for now. (diff) | |
download | java-1041c08acbf2e232e3a18f4f57482c432a65e386.tar.gz java-1041c08acbf2e232e3a18f4f57482c432a65e386.tar.bz2 java-1041c08acbf2e232e3a18f4f57482c432a65e386.zip |
dev-util/visualvm: added desktop files
(Portage version: 2.1.10.43/svn/Linux x86_64, unsigned Manifest commit)
svn path=/java-overlay/; revision=8937
Diffstat (limited to 'dev-util')
-rw-r--r-- | dev-util/visualvm/ChangeLog | 8 | ||||
-rw-r--r-- | dev-util/visualvm/Manifest | 20 | ||||
-rw-r--r-- | dev-util/visualvm/visualvm-1.3.3-r1.ebuild (renamed from dev-util/visualvm/visualvm-1.3.3.ebuild) | 22 | ||||
-rw-r--r-- | dev-util/visualvm/visualvm-1.3.3-r8.ebuild (renamed from dev-util/visualvm/visualvm-1.3.3-r7.ebuild) | 22 |
4 files changed, 41 insertions, 31 deletions
diff --git a/dev-util/visualvm/ChangeLog b/dev-util/visualvm/ChangeLog index 33e2d92b..b17c2548 100644 --- a/dev-util/visualvm/ChangeLog +++ b/dev-util/visualvm/ChangeLog @@ -2,6 +2,14 @@ # Copyright 1999-2011 Gentoo Foundation; Distributed under the GPL v2 # $Header: $ +*visualvm-1.3.3-r8 (26 Dec 2011) +*visualvm-1.3.3-r1 (26 Dec 2011) + + 26 Dec 2011; Miroslav Šulc <fordfrog@gentoo.org> -visualvm-1.3.3.ebuild, + +visualvm-1.3.3-r1.ebuild, -visualvm-1.3.3-r7.ebuild, + +visualvm-1.3.3-r8.ebuild: + Added desktop files + *visualvm-1.3.3-r7 (19 Dec 2011) *visualvm-1.3.3 (19 Dec 2011) diff --git a/dev-util/visualvm/Manifest b/dev-util/visualvm/Manifest index 85e186ce..e1706fc2 100644 --- a/dev-util/visualvm/Manifest +++ b/dev-util/visualvm/Manifest @@ -1,24 +1,10 @@ ------BEGIN PGP SIGNED MESSAGE----- -Hash: SHA1 - AUX missing_zip-1.3.patch 2387 RMD160 9eff545c2ac6616b1af6f5d22372d545cb1ad4f6 SHA1 f0d0e6d6eb1b8b6e8308291da3abb64dc4fba99d SHA256 680842157f749b631ffe259d0694aae0657d158b580c201c29eebc0180e5b2dc AUX netbeans-platform-version.patch 435 RMD160 88fc0ba7def717577e6e89d923e15c53a73403ee SHA1 35265290c793d5124782cf27ec1f929bdb7afd79 SHA256 2ab6b242b105952962ad5893cb9249c019912aad8d41b909e8afeadfefa24515 AUX visualvm.clusters 19 RMD160 a8161acbae079a8d1857b9b09af9cd50c478e1f3 SHA1 00610db2193ac777b462d026e180c1ca10fb4b3c SHA256 8025e901b00ea8f092c63ba0a5aabcb85d8c271d2cdec85b26ba698ff0c669d7 DIST netbeans-profiler-visualvm_release701.tar.gz 1767450 RMD160 66e9a35d8092b9fec1f7e400c635d531355bf92e SHA1 10e145b19e5d544cd85f160d207369404fcd878d SHA256 0056c6b7da3fa9499b87319caa6b431b935b48f9579f7c94ec169777ecd2c238 DIST visualvm_133-src.tar.gz 978434 RMD160 4bad0d1b1ca806a40c511e5786459f8088c8b4e9 SHA1 d61bb9a2a9fec21908299f5ef414c088af6dad29 SHA256 43f4d5c892d3654ada9d07f2a8dc1c1b98db671f558a5c7fa7e9db7e86b7ca81 DIST visualvm_harness-1.3.tar.gz 147059 RMD160 85edd84d5cb01568f21b133ed1da522442a3906c SHA1 a7aa102c96e1dcd863fb45956404dda5c41fe99f SHA256 e66eb2fe2b4703896d329ca0e0a8f5e89c5a0097dbad72f9211e14d71401f585 -EBUILD visualvm-1.3.3-r7.ebuild 1887 RMD160 0357be4ba9cc5654166f3b4ff30d06ea01376f3f SHA1 1e97ea3d0276635aa32635b49d1091ef067c0cbf SHA256 e9733804e453ef3c0f8a571dcc060d3688597910276cee9d2be1a939d6065fff -EBUILD visualvm-1.3.3.ebuild 1890 RMD160 0be2f7a0fd43180ccf0a17f1a46ab840dd81ad3e SHA1 0499d6401604c9879ec8afb1cae36b8b881f6651 SHA256 42a2456caa972954e8961b954e9f9931f7aaddc268684731647aff42eaf8e146 -MISC ChangeLog 787 RMD160 b22554df95f33f1bc1fbbcb795ec27b1e721fe87 SHA1 4010a6da3f09c47d6bd9b09cc353078fc3df6b65 SHA256 bb4f477862197f36fe50b4d867dbaead101e05b8ecd06ae4f2a0c2c5c34dbac2 +EBUILD visualvm-1.3.3-r1.ebuild 2089 RMD160 945bbe0964c5062ff36dae83570a57d8615e89bf SHA1 2e2647e98e0a7ef6f83022b33c3ad1c17ca87e5c SHA256 f181186eacbc679421d6c8e034b861096a0de7765f6dc907905793dbaa556e25 +EBUILD visualvm-1.3.3-r8.ebuild 2089 RMD160 768f04a04d203e7f063b31a589e675121d68c6ad SHA1 cbf9feb0c4378bae1266c27843a97c748b6b8b90 SHA256 e34e9e52d1343b3abf0c3a8e39118b03702dd3c6ccdc8e6221163b4a73a92231 +MISC ChangeLog 1038 RMD160 88d0923c9f7aa7be408e80c268a6fc5769896119 SHA1 994285823af4e0bd19ea767237884295d60a7eb7 SHA256 ccb807c56ca4b6120aa433ef0e22be1ba8aa5305fceb08e28069f5ff857044ea MISC metadata.xml 376 RMD160 400defff92d0aa29672a5f9a25dd184904fff905 SHA1 3a1bedcce2b7789921cf3851d97d75e156ee4f8f SHA256 ca303aff216f2c2148d9c66a707e15f75fbaf91735311bb8c970fe37d0a5b7a0 ------BEGIN PGP SIGNATURE----- -Version: GnuPG v2.0.17 (GNU/Linux) - -iQEcBAEBAgAGBQJO702wAAoJEIUJ+svaV163W4wIAKHrtaf3dkVSXQHk4hMQoldt -464h8s+QVYhQwczd4oDIl9AWkeRCSY1Zlu3q5tkfqkEk8BdERNea0z4Igb8OeL2c -fQyGw1+P28UsGU9PVzDdqCT98i3lSMIv1UUH0+sMI5G8xyEhXGDWHby6b4jjbrFx -SFJy7lYS3tvO6ftWb12ZZ17K4gaQC/Y1+AUkpPJqDZv44TvqYwonES01kU8mtNO3 -26BVjr4jl3oPM5ET1NqCTICVsrjIjjOKygK4GeGq78NdfcPtP7ayU/QeuG9xNJ21 -qnhsRq5Zk+2KSZeoeWQkVrIpcMHCAtYDauJ2YLKFz/4nL/3MmsCcj+O1GRZuJVU= -=AY3+ ------END PGP SIGNATURE----- diff --git a/dev-util/visualvm/visualvm-1.3.3.ebuild b/dev-util/visualvm/visualvm-1.3.3-r1.ebuild index ee87f7af..9be27544 100644 --- a/dev-util/visualvm/visualvm-1.3.3.ebuild +++ b/dev-util/visualvm/visualvm-1.3.3-r1.ebuild @@ -10,7 +10,7 @@ VISUALVM_PKG="visualvm_harness-1.3" VISUALVM_TARBALL="visualvm_133-src.tar.gz" NETBEANS_PROFILER_TARBALL="netbeans-profiler-visualvm_release701.tar.gz" -DESCRIPTION="A harness to build VisualVM using Free Software build tools" +DESCRIPTION="Integrates commandline JDK tools and profiling capabilites." HOMEPAGE="http://icedtea.classpath.org" SRC_URI=" http://icedtea.classpath.org/download/visualvm/${VISUALVM_PKG}.tar.gz @@ -47,11 +47,7 @@ src_prepare() { } src_configure() { - local vmhandle=icedtea-${SLOT} - has_version "<=dev-java/icedtea-6.1.10.4:6" && vmhandle=icedtea6 - - local vmhome - vmhome="$(GENTOO_VM=${vmhandle} java-config -O)" || die + local vmhome=`get_vmhome` econf NB_PLATFORM=platform \ --bindir="${vmhome}"/bin \ @@ -71,6 +67,18 @@ src_compile() { src_install() { emake DESTDIR="${ED}" install - # Don't install .desktop, file collision. + # Don't install default .desktop, file collision. + local vmhome=`get_vmhome` rm -rf "${ED}"/usr/share + make_desktop_entry "${vmhome}/bin/jvisualvm" "OpenJDK ${SLOT} VisualVM" "java" "Development;Java;" +} + +get_vmhome() { + local vmhandle=icedtea-${SLOT} + has_version "<=dev-java/icedtea-6.1.10.4:6" && vmhandle=icedtea6 + + local vmhome + vmhome="$(GENTOO_VM=${vmhandle} java-config -O)" || die + + echo "${vmhome}" } diff --git a/dev-util/visualvm/visualvm-1.3.3-r7.ebuild b/dev-util/visualvm/visualvm-1.3.3-r8.ebuild index b68d5fa7..c006a278 100644 --- a/dev-util/visualvm/visualvm-1.3.3-r7.ebuild +++ b/dev-util/visualvm/visualvm-1.3.3-r8.ebuild @@ -10,7 +10,7 @@ VISUALVM_PKG="visualvm_harness-1.3" VISUALVM_TARBALL="visualvm_133-src.tar.gz" NETBEANS_PROFILER_TARBALL="netbeans-profiler-visualvm_release701.tar.gz" -DESCRIPTION="A harness to build VisualVM using Free Software build tools" +DESCRIPTION="Integrates commandline JDK tools and profiling capabilites." HOMEPAGE="http://icedtea.classpath.org" SRC_URI=" http://icedtea.classpath.org/download/visualvm/${VISUALVM_PKG}.tar.gz @@ -47,11 +47,7 @@ src_prepare() { } src_configure() { - local vmhandle=icedtea-${SLOT} - has_version "<=dev-java/icedtea-7.2.0:7" && vmhandle=icedtea7 - - local vmhome - vmhome="$(GENTOO_VM=${vmhandle} java-config -O)" || die + local vmhome=`get_vmhome` econf NB_PLATFORM=platform \ --bindir="${vmhome}"/bin \ @@ -71,6 +67,18 @@ src_compile() { src_install() { emake DESTDIR="${ED}" install - # Don't install .desktop, file collision. + # Don't install default .desktop, file collision. + local vmhome=`get_vmhome` rm -rf "${ED}"/usr/share + make_desktop_entry "${vmhome}/bin/jvisualvm" "OpenJDK ${SLOT} VisualVM" "java" "Development;Java;" +} + +get_vmhome() { + local vmhandle=icedtea-${SLOT} + has_version "<=dev-java/icedtea-6.1.10.4:6" && vmhandle=icedtea6 + + local vmhome + vmhome="$(GENTOO_VM=${vmhandle} java-config -O)" || die + + echo "${vmhome}" } |